Tim Hodgson 2025 Winner
Minister of Energy and Natural Resources at Government of Canada
Government of CanadaTim Hodgson is Canada’s Minister of Energy and Natural Resources and a former executive in global finance. Elected as the Member of Parliament for Markham–Thornhill in 2025, Hodgson brings decades of leadership experience from roles at Goldman Sachs, the Bank of Canada, PwC, and Hydro One. A former CEO of Goldman Sachs Canada and special advisor to Bank of Canada Governor Mark Carney, he has worked across New York, London, Silicon Valley, and Toronto. A Canadian Armed Forces veteran and lifelong public servant, Hodgson now leads Canada’s energy portfolio at a pivotal moment for the country’s climate and industrial strategy.
